Head of Information Governance

Reference: APR20269087

Location: Flexible in United Kingdom

Contract: Permanent

Hours: Full-time, 37.5 hours per week

Salary: £53,095.00 - £56,687.00 Per Annum

Benefits: Pension Scheme, Life Assurance Scheme, 34 days' Annual Leave

You’ll love this role if you’re motivated by using information well to deliver real-world impact. This is a senior, influential role with the opportunity to shape how information is trusted, protected and used across the UK’s largest nature conservation organisation.

As Head of Information Governance, you’ll provide enterprise-wide leadership for information management, ensuring our information assets are compliant, well-governed and enable confident decision-making, regulatory assurance and conservation impact. You’ll set the strategic direction for information governance, lead organisational change, and work closely with digital, legal and operational colleagues to embed effective, future‑ready approaches including the use of platforms such as Microsoft Purview.

You’ll lead a specialist team and work with colleagues across the organisation, from Board level to front‑line delivery, building capability, accountability and confidence in how information is managed. If you’re excited by complexity, collaboration and making governance work in practice, not just on paper, then this role offers a genuine opportunity to make a difference.
